> From: Cliff Scott [mailto:[email protected]] > > I'm running 4.2.6 with the 4.2.6 Guest Additions and Extension pack. I only > figured it out by accident. First on OS/2 I had USB working and then enabled > the 2nd cpu and the USB access died. Turned off the 2nd cpu and it came > back. > A while later I loaded WinXP and couldn't get the USB to work. Tried all the > usual things that work in a stand alone system to no avail. Finally I looked > on the VBox forum for messages relating to that and found one that > mentioned > that the multiple CPU usage was a common problem. Turned off the 2nd cpu > and > the USB worked. I think that was on version 4.2.4. Just tried it on 4.2.6 and > it still has the same problem. WinXP comes up with a message that the USB > device is "not recognized". I had the same issue with trying to attach a USB > printer to WinXP. What ever is the issue it is still there.
